This Winter Sightseeing Tour In Idaho’s Backcountry Is Absolutely Majestic

It’s an undeniable fact that Idaho is downright gorgeous during winter. The entire state turns into a winter wonderland this time of year. There are few things as magical as getting to see Idaho’s snow-covered mountains up close and personal, and this winter sightseeing tour allows you to do just that. If you aren’t a skier or snowboarder, don’t worry. These tours are designed for those who wish to delve into the snowy backcountry without breaking a sweat! Check it out.

Doesn’t this look like an incredible way to spend a winter day? Idaho winters are absolutely heavenly! Check out this Enchanting Guest Ranch In Idaho That Makes For The Perfect Winter Getaway.